Haverholme Priory, par., S. Lincolnshire, 291 ac., pop. 21; an ancient mansion, seat of Dowager Countess of Winchester, occupies the site of the monastery (1139) which once stood here.
(John Bartholomew, Gazetteer of the British Isles (1887))
